marcoscaceres commented 3 years ago

What progress has your spec made in the last 12 months?

We added SecureContext IDL extended attributes to the spec and have been moving towards enabling the API only via permissions policy #112.

A rewrite of the algorithms (into actual algorithms) is underway, but not expected to complete until next year.

Is anything blocking your spec from moving to CR?

The stuff above needs to land and ship... plus we need to decide if there is anything else that should go into the spec.
